Microsoft Azure SQL Management Integration manages the Auditing and Threat Policies for Azure SQL. In order to connect to the AzureSQLManagement using either Cortex XSOAR Azure App or the Self-Deployed Azure App, use one of the following methods: - *Authorization Code Flow* (Recommended). - *Device Code Flow*. - *Azure Managed Identities* - *Client Credentials Flow*. # Self-Deployed Application To use a self-configured Azure application, you need to add a [new Azure App Registration in the Azure Portal](https://docs.microsoft.com/en-us/graph/auth-register-app-v2#register-a-new-application-using-the-azure-portal). The application must have *user_impersonation* permission and must allow public client flows (found under the **Authentication** section of the app). We appreciate your feedback on the quality and usability of the integration to help us identify issues, fix them, and continually improve. #### Cortex XSOAR Azure App In order to use the Cortex XSOAR Azure application, use the default application ID (8f9010bb-4efe-4cfa-a197-98a2694b7e0c). You only need to fill in your subscription ID and resource group name. You can find your resource group and subscription ID in the Azure Portal. For a more detailed explanation, visit [this page](https://xsoar.pan.dev/docs/reference/articles/microsoft-integrations---authentication#azure-integrations-params). ### Azure Managed Identities Authentication ##### Note: This option is relevant only if the integration is running on Azure VM. Follow one of these steps for authentication based on Azure Managed Identities: - ##### To use System Assigned Managed Identity - In the **Authentication Type** drop-down list, select **Azure Managed Identities** and leave the **Azure Managed Identities Client ID** field empty. - ##### To use User Assigned Managed Identity 1. Go to [Azure Portal](https://portal.azure.com/) -> **Managed Identities**. 2. Select your User Assigned Managed Identity -> copy the Client ID -> paste it in the **Azure Managed Identities client ID** field in the instance configuration. 3. In the **Authentication Type** drop-down list, select **Azure Managed Identities**. To configure a Microsoft integration that uses this authorization flow with a self-deployed Azure application: 1. In the **Authentication Type** field, select the **Client Credentials** option. 2. In the **Application ID** field, enter your Client/Application ID. 3. In the **Tenant ID** field, enter your Tenant ID . 4. In the **Client Secret** field, enter your Client Secret. 5. Click **Test** to validate the URLs, token, and connection 6. Save the instance. ### Testing authentication and connectivity If you are using Device Code Flow or Authorization Code Flow, for testing your authentication and connectivity to the Azure SQL Management service run the ***!azure-sql-auth-test*** command. If you are using Client Credentials Flow, click **Test** when you are configuring the instance.
